Intelligent Power Module (IPM) Interfaces Optocouplers Market Analysis:<?

The global Intelligent Power Module (IPM) Interfaces Optocouplers market was valued at USD 80.7 million in 2024 and is projected to reach USD 116.4 million by 2032, growing at a compound annual growth rate (CAGR) of 4.5% during the forecast period (2024–2032). The market growth is primarily driven by the increasing adoption of electric vehicles, renewable energy systems, and industrial automation across various sectors.

Intelligent Power Module (IPM) Interfaces Optocouplers Market Overview:


Intelligent Power Module (IPM) Interfaces Optocouplers are semiconductor components used to provide isolation and safe signal transmission between high-voltage and low-voltage circuits. These devices are critical in systems involving high-power switching, offering short propagation delay, fast IGBT switching capabilities, high common mode transient immunity (CMTI), and operation over wide temperature ranges. Reinforced insulation makes them well-suited for interfacing with IPMs in motor drives, power inverters, and other control systems.
